Hundreds evacuated after Egon eruption

KUPANG, East Nusa Tenggara: The Sikka regental government has helped evacuate hundreds of residents living near the slopes of the currently active Mount Egon volcano, a senior official said on Wednesday.

Residents in the two subdistricts were evacuated after the volcano again started spewing out hot ashes beginning last week, said Sikka Regent Alex Longginus. The residents will live in temporary shelters until the volcanic activity ceased, said Alex.

Earlier, an official of the East Nusa Tenggara provincial government called on residents and mountain climbers not to climb the raging volcano for safety reasons. -- JP
